Passengers on an ocean liner discover they are dead and traveling to an unknown afterlife. Each person must face judgment for how they lived their life.

Outward Bound is a 1930 American pre-Code drama film based on the 1923 hit play of the same name by Sutton Vane. It stars Leslie Howard, Douglas Fairbanks Jr., Helen Chandler, Beryl Mercer, Montagu Love, Alison Skipworth, Alec B. Francis, and Dudley Digges. The film was later remade, with some changes, as Between Two Worlds (1944). (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
